Boston Celtics center Kelly Olynyk became an unrestricted free agent on Tuesday after the Celtics renounced the 7-foot center’s qualifying offer, according to ESPN’s Adrian Wojnarowski‏.

USA Today’s Sam Amick reported the Atlanta Hawks and Indiana Pacers were on the short list of landing spots.

A four-year veteran out of Gonzaga, Olynyk averaged nine points, 4.8 rebounds and two assists per game last season with the Celtics.
